#8DE80E Hex Color Code

#8DE80E

The Hexadecimal Color #8DE80E is a contrast shade of Lawn Green. #8DE80E RGB value is rgb(141, 232, 14). RGB Color Model of #8DE80E consists of 55% red, 90% green and 5% blue. HSL color Mode of #8DE80E has 85°(degrees) Hue, 89% Saturation and 48% Lightness. #8DE80E color has an wavelength of 566.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#8DE80E is #99FF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#8DE80E is #8E1. The Closest Color to #8DE80E is #7CFC00. Official Name of #8DE80E Hex Code is Inch Worm.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#8DE80E is 39 Cyan 0 Magenta 94 Yellow 9 Black and #8DE80E CMY is 39, 0, 94.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#8DE80E is hsl(85,89,48,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(85, 94, 91).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#8DE80E is 39.92, 63.41, 10.55.
Hex8 Value of #8DE80E is #8DE80EFF. Decimal Value of #8DE80E is 9299982 and Octal Value of #8DE80E is 43364016. Binary Value of #8DE80E is 10001101, 11101000, 1110 and Android of #8DE80E is 4287490062 / 0xff8de80e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#8DE80E is 0.351, 0.557, 0.557 and YIQ Color Space of #8DE80E is 179.939, 15.8165, -87.0881.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#8DE80E is 54.78, 79.62, 11.36.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#8DE80E is 83.66, -55.11, 79.96.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#8DE80E is 83.66, -45.36, 97.51.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#8DE80E is 83.66, 97.11, 124.58. Hunter Lab variable of #8DE80E is 79.63, -49.87, 47.89.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#8DE80E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
